Eastern Snowball Viburnum
Viburnum
Bed NE1 In Mike's garden
A large rounded deciduous shrub bearing showy round 'snowball' flower clusters that open green and turn pure white in late spring.

About eastern snowball viburnum
General information about the species — not specific to this planting.
At a glance
Sun
full sun to part shade
Water
moderate
Mature size
8-12 ft × 8-12 ft
Bloom
Round 'snowball' clusters, opening green then white, late spring.
Pruning
Prune just after flowering (blooms on old wood); thin oldest stems to renew; remove dead/crossing wood.
